執行計划是什么呢?比如你執行一條sql語句,查詢優化器會為這條sql語句設計執行方式,交給執行器去執行,查詢優化器設計的執行方式就是執行計划。 EXPLAIN可以打印出語句的執行計划。 那么,執行計划主要是由什么組成的呢?答案是操作符(個人理解)。 執行計划是由各類操作符組成的一顆樹 ...
查看執行計划 explain for select from t where id level id直接能標識出具體的執行的順序,還是挺直觀的。 但操作符定義的比較另類,估計一時半會是記不住的。 另外,表關聯時被驅動表已經執行了SSEK 和BLKUP ,為啥還要執行CSCN 操作,不清楚這是為什么 感覺上不可理解。 ...
2020-08-15 16:49 1 1588 推薦指數:
執行計划是什么呢?比如你執行一條sql語句,查詢優化器會為這條sql語句設計執行方式,交給執行器去執行,查詢優化器設計的執行方式就是執行計划。 EXPLAIN可以打印出語句的執行計划。 那么,執行計划主要是由什么組成的呢?答案是操作符(個人理解)。 執行計划是由各類操作符組成的一顆樹 ...
); 3、10046查看Oracle數據庫中的執行計划 能夠得到SQL執行計划中每一個執行步驟所消耗的邏輯讀,物 ...
基於ORACLE的應用系統很多性能問題,是由應用系統SQL性能低劣引起的,所以,SQL的性能優化很重要,分析與優化SQL的性能我們一般通過查看該SQL的執行計划,本文就如何看懂執行計划,以及如何通過分析執行計划對SQL進行優化做相應說明。 一、什么是執行計划(explain plan ...
基於ORACLE的應用系統很多性能問題,是由應用系統SQL性能低劣引起的,所以,SQL的性能優化很重要,分析與優化SQL的性能我們一般通過查看該SQL的執行計划,本文就如何看懂執行計划,以及如何通過分析執行計划對SQL進行優化做相應說明。 一、什么是執行計划(explain plan ...
基於ORACLE的應用系統很多性能問題,是由應用系統SQL性能低劣引起的,所以,SQL的性能優化很重要,分析與優化SQL的性能我們一般通過查看該SQL的執行計划,本文就如何看懂執行計划,以及如何通過分析執行計划對SQL進行優化做相應說明。 一、什么是執行計划(explain plan ...
最近由於公司項目需要使用DM數據庫,現在就官方源碼修改了,完美支持達夢數據庫的代碼生成器。官方說的v3.0.RELEASE版本支持達夢數據庫,不知道說的支持包括支持代碼生成器么? 懷着興奮的心情,興高采烈地試了這個版本,結果尷尬了,報錯:不支持的數據類型。 再這么說 ...
DM達夢數據庫License的替換安裝 參考官方的《DM8安裝手冊.pdf》,有如下步驟: 首先,找到 DM 服務器所在的目錄,方法是以 root 用戶或安裝用戶登錄到 Linux 系統,啟動終端,執行以下命令即可進入 DM 服務器程序安裝的目錄: 關閉數據庫服務器,在RH7.9 ...
創建安裝用戶 為了減少對操作系統的影響,用戶不應該以 root 系統用戶來安裝和運行 DM。用戶 可以在安裝之前為 DM 創建一個專用的系統用戶。可參考以下示例創建系統用戶和組(並 指定用戶 ID 和組 ID) 解壓安裝包 簡易方式:windows 本地解壓 ...